#d1a6d1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d1a6d1 is composed of 82% red, 65.1% green and 82%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 20.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 300 degrees, a saturation of 31.9% and a lightness of 73.5%. #d1a6d1 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#a34da3.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

#d1a6d1 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d1a6d1 has RGB values of R:209, G:166, B:209 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.21, Y:0,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13739729.
